First he engineered a war with Denmark, called the Second Schleswig War. Schleswig is a region in Denmark, on the border with Germany; there's a lot of German people there. Long story short, Denmark tried to take full control of Schleswig, defying an older agreement that they wouldn't, and Prussia declared war; Prussia also convinced Austria to help. Austria and Prussia quickly defeated Denmark, and parts of southern Denmark were taken by the victors.Then Bismarck turned on his ally, Austria. Prussia came up with trumped up charges involving Austria's control of the new territory taken from Denmark, and declared war. Italy, which was also trying to unify (Austria controlled big chunks of northern Italy), also got on board. Other German states took sides, notably Bavaria, one of the larger German kingdoms, joined Austria's side. Prussia and their German allies quickly won. The treaty ending their war made Prussia the most powerful player in German politics and permanently removed Austria from Germany.France was the next target. France was one of the most powerful countries in Europe, and the major opponent to German unification. Again, Bismarck arranged for a fight (he altered a message to France's Emperor from the King of Prussia to make it insulting). The Prussians again allied with other German states, and again quickly defeated their foe. In the climactic battle, the Prussians even captured the French Emperor himself.After defeating France, the King of Bavaria was convinced (some would say "tricked") to write a letter to the King of Prussia that said that the Prussian King should become the Emperor of a newly united Germany. The King of Prussia accepted this and was crowned at Versailles palace in France; Germany was officially unified. Meanwhile, with their Emperor captured, the French government collapsed and became a republic again (which, except for being ruled by Nazi Germany briefly, it has been ever since).
Prussia was an important part of the coalition which defeated Napoleon and occupied Paris in 1814. Prussia provided half the troops which won the Waterloo campaign in 1815, finally defeating Napoleon and once again occupting Paris. Prussia once more beat France in 1870, thus completing the unification of Germany; the German Empire was proclaimed from the Palace of Versailles. Finally, another German Empire under Hitler defeated France in 1940. That seems to make 4 times, though both Prussia and Germany had allies to help them each time.

Otto von Bismarck wanted to unify German states. He was born when the German confederation was just created. His main priority was to help Prussia have the most powerful army in all of Europe which it eventually did. Bismarck was clever and would manipulate his ways into getting more territory. SO basically he wanted to unite all German states making the German Empire with Prussia as the core
